Trees Hit By Cars is a neatly designed photo essay in the form of a book, with writings by Charles McLeod, and Toby Kamps. Adam Frelin writes “Each tree in this book has experienced at least one run-in with a car… Unforgiving and seemingly impervious, a tree proves to be a formidable obstacle, concealing tragedy through scraped trunks and broken bits of bark.” Edition of 500, signed/numbered.
